Benin | Granted an Operating Licence to Amazone Airlines

Benin’s National Civil Aviation Agency (ANAC) has granted an operating license to Amazone Airlines following a regulatory review concluded on 13 February 2026, paving the way for the new carrier to begin commercial operations.

Developed to boost tourism and regional connectivity, Amazone Airlines aims direct international links, potentially with Qatar Airways cooperation, following a 2025 proposal.

The move advances government plans to strengthen air connectivity and tourism, with potential to increase traffic through Cotonou’s Bernardin Gantin International Airport, which is being expanded to triple passenger capacity as Benin targets more than 2 million international visitors a year.

Benin’s National Civil Aviation Agency said approval followed verification of operating procedures, crew and technical qualifications, and a compliant safety management system.

Details on ownership, initial fleet and launch timing have not been disclosed.Amazone Airlines will enter a competitive market already served by major international and regional airlines, amid sector headwinds typical in Africa, high operating costs, significant taxes and fuel prices, and relatively low load factors (73.4% in Africa in December 2025 versus 83.7% globally).
